As Donald Trump continues to issue social media posts and presidential “executive orders” – 17 official pages listing them as of 30 March – there are of course countless attempts to decipher and explain any possible strategies behind his actions.
Does he have a plan or a strategy?
Is he just positioning himself for a third term as president, prohibited by the American Constitution?
In the USA, Trump himself has confirmed that he’s considering running for a third term as president despite the Constitution, reinforcing earlier comments and echoing the words of his former chief strategist and longtime alt-right promoter Steve Bannon. Trump made his comment on March 30 after Bannon told the right-wing NewsNation television channel on March 19 that he and others are working on ways for Trump to seek a third term:
“We’re working on it. I think we’ll have a couple of alternatives. We’ll see what the definition of term limit is.”
Trump has already signed another executive order seeking to overhaul elections and threatening to pull federal funding from states that don’t comply – an order likely to be challenged because states have broad authority to set their own election rules. And Trump has a long history of disputing elections when he loses, especially the false claim that he was cheated out of a win in 2020.
Globally, as he overturns the rules-based world order we have known for the past 80 years and potentially damages America’s international image, some interpretations suggest he has a longer-term goal to address a perceived threat from China – even though his apparent current focus is on purported attempts to end wars in Ukraine and Gaza.
